90th Congress > House > Vote 230
Description: CONFERENCE REPORT ON H.R. 611, A BILL TO ESTABLISH A FEDERAL JUDICIAL CENTER; TO PASS THE REPORT RECOMMENDING THAT THE HOUSE RECEDE AND CONCUR WITH THE SENATE, WITH AN AMENDMENT WHICH ADOPTS THE SENATE VERSION WHICH HAS THREE IMPORTANT DIFFERENCES: 1) THE CENTER IS TO BE LOCATED "WITHIN THE JUDICIAL BRANCH OF THE GOVERNMENT" RATHER THAN "THE ADMINISTRAFIVE OFFICE OF THE U.S. COURTS" 2) THE DIRECTOR OF THE CENTER SHALL HIRE PERSONNEL RATHER THAN TH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S AND 3) ONLY ACTIVE JUDGES MAY SERVE ON THE BOARD OF THE CENTER AND NO BOARK MEMBER MAY ALSO BE A MEMBER OF THE JUDICIAL CONFERENCE.
Original source documents: Digest of the Congressional Record vol. 113-199, p. H1;

Vote Ideological Breakdown
This chart describes how members voted on the rollcall. Members are placed according to their NOMINATE ideological scores.
A cutting line divides the vote into those expected to vote "Yea" and those expected to vote "Nay". The shaded heatmap reflects
the expected probability of voting "Yea". You can select points or regions to subset the members listed above and below.
